summ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orNitin A Kamble <nitin.a.kamble@intel.com>2012-03-15 11:42:24 -0700
committerRichard Purdie <richard.purdie@linuxfoundation.org>2012-03-19 13:31:32 +0000
commitb1ce043d46f7465daf320d80ddd0db0b69def917 (patch)
treecda2e02be6236176e21fc20fbed26c0da4cf732b
parentbf52e32e09423056c8c78760db22ca7497ec357d (diff)
downloadopenembedded-core-b1ce043d46f7465daf320d80ddd0db0b69def917.tar.gz
openembedded-core-b1ce043d46f7465daf320d80ddd0db0b69def917.tar.bz2
openembedded-core-b1ce043d46f7465daf320d80ddd0db0b69def917.tar.xz
openembedded-core-b1ce043d46f7465daf320d80ddd0db0b69def917.zip
pciutils: fix a do_compile failure
Avoid this issue: | ln -s libpci.so.3.1.9 libpci.so | ln: failed to create symbolic link `libpci.so': File exists | make[1]: *** [libpci.so] Error 1 | make[1]: Leaving directory `/srv/home/nitin/builds/build-multilib/tmp/work/x86_64-poky-linux/pciutils-3.1.9-r0/pciutils-3.1.9/lib' | make: *** [lib/libpci.so] Error 2 | ERROR: oe_runmake failed NOTE: package pciutils-3.1.9-r0: task do_compile: Failed PR not bumped as there are no changes in the output packages. Signed-off-by: Nitin A Kamble <nitin.a.kamble@intel.com>
-rw-r--r--meta/recipes-bsp/pciutils/pciutils_3.1.9.bb5
1 files changed, 5 insertions, 0 deletions
diff --git a/meta/recipes-bsp/pciutils/pciutils_3.1.9.bb b/meta/recipes-bsp/pciutils/pciutils_3.1.9.bb
index 51e747604..2c969d970 100644
--- a/meta/recipes-bsp/pciutils/pciutils_3.1.9.bb
+++ b/meta/recipes-bsp/pciutils/pciutils_3.1.9.bb
@@ -33,6 +33,11 @@ do_configure () {
)
}
+do_compile_prepend () {
+ # Avoid this error: ln: failed to create symbolic link `libpci.so': File exists
+ rm -f ${S}/lib/libpci.so
+}
+
export PREFIX = "${prefix}"
export SBINDIR = "${sbindir}"
export SHAREDIR = "${datadir}"